'Have you ever tried to find the most cited paper in supply chain management research? I have done so. For this purpose, I used the term “supply chain” in Web of Knowledge for a topic search. The winning paper is titled Information distortion in a supply chain: The bullwhip effect and the authors are Hau L. Lee, V. Padmanabhan, and Seungjin Whang.

Repair May Be the Needed Fix to Increase “Return on Returns.”

ModusLink Corporation

'Returns, especially consumer electronic devices, are a big business. According to a 2011 study by Accenture, between 11% and 20% of all consumer electronics (CE) devices purchased in the U.S. are returned. With volumes like that, it’s important for both retailers and manufacturers to manage returned items in ways that maximize their bottom line. The unopened box items are easy to process, but what can be done with items that have been opened, used or even damaged in transit or during the return

Revolutionize Your Forecast Precision Based on Market and Product Attributes

Logility

Today’s product portfolios c an contain hundreds of thousands SKUs. In some cases a company must manage several million. This is not to say a company will have this many product families. In fact, many of these SKUs are based on product configurations within a product family. For example a style of shoe can have a SKU for each gender, color, size and width.
